Hvad Betyder ‘Truncate’?
Definition af ‘Truncate’
Ordet ‘truncate’ kommer fra det latinske ord ‘truncatus’, som betyder at skære eller afkorte. I teknologisk kontekst henviser det til at forkorte data eller reducere størrelsen på en datastruktur uden at slette den fuldstændigt. Når man taler om truncation, handler det ofte om at fjerne dele af data, hvilket kan være nyttigt for at bevare relevans og præcision i databehandlingssystemer.
Oprindelse og Historie
Historisk set begyndte brugen af termen ‘truncate’ at blive fremtrædende i databaseteknologi i midten af 1980’erne, da behovet for effektiv datastyring voksede. I takt med, at databaser blev mere komplekse, blev det nødvendigt at udvikle metoder til hurtigt at fjerne indhold, hvilket førte til opfindelsen af truncation som en standard funktion i mange databasestyringssystemer.
Hvordan ‘Truncate’ Anvendes i IT og Teknologi
Truncate i Databaseadministration
I databaseadministration spiller truncation en central rolle i vedligeholdelsen af databaser. Denne metode giver administratorer mulighed for at rydde op i store datamængder på en hurtig og effektiv måde. For eksempel kan man anvende TRUNCATE TABLE kommandoen i SQL for at fjerne alle rækker i en tabel uden at registrere hver enkelt sletning, hvilket gør det væsentligt hurtigere end en standard DELETE kommando.
Truncate i Programmeringssprog
Udover databaser anvendes truncate også i forskellige programmeringssprog. For eksempel kan man i Python bruge metoder som truncate() til at forkorte størrelsen på filer eller datastrukturer. På denne måde kan udviklere effektivt håndtere ressourcer og optimere ydeevnen i applikationer.
Truncate vs. Delete: Hvad Er Forskellen?
En hyppig sammenligning i databehandling er forskellen mellem truncation og deletion. Mens DELETE sletter specifikke rækker i en tabel og registrerer hver ændring, fjerner TRUNCATE alle rækker uden at registrere hver enkelt handling. Dette gør truncation til en hurtigere løsning, men det er vigtigt at overveje dataintegriteten, da truncation ikke kan fortrydes.
Tekniske Aspekter ved ‘Truncate’
Hvordan Truncate Fungerer i SQL
I SQL anvendes kommandoen TRUNCATE til at tømme data fra en tabel. Det fungerer ved at fjerne alle rækker og frigive plads, hvilket resulterer i en mere effektiv anvendelse af systemressourcer. En væsentlig fordel ved at bruge truncation er, at det som regel er hurtigere end en klassisk DELETE operation, da det ikke kræver gentagne logging handlinger for hver enkelt række.
Effektivitet af Truncate i Datahåndtering
Effektiviteten af truncation kan ikke undervurderes, når det kommer til datahåndtering. Det hjælper med at forbedre ydeevnen af databasens operationer og gør det muligt for systemer at håndtere store datamængder effektivt. Desuden kan truncation ofte hjælpe med at genoprette systemets hastighed, når databasen er bebyrdet med for store datamængder.
Data Integritet og Truncate
Mens truncation er en hurtig metode til at rydde data, er det afgørende at overveje data integritet. Når man anvender TRUNCATE, bliver dataene permanent fjernet, hvilket betyder, at det ikke er muligt at gendanne dem senere. Derfor skal brugen af truncation overvejes nøje i forhold til det overordnede datastruktur og behovene i applikationen.
Hvornår Skal Man Bruge ‘Truncate’?
Situationer, Hvor Truncate Er Det Bedste Valg
Der er specifikke situationer, hvor truncation er den bedste løsning. Hvis en tabel har brug for at blive tømt helt, og der ikke er behov for at bevare dataene, vil brugen af TRUNCATE være ideel. Dette gælder især i udviklingsmiljøer eller når man arbejder med midlertidige data, hvor opbevaring af historiske data ikke er nødvendig.
Risici ved at Anvende Truncate
Risiciene ved at anvende truncation inkluderer muligheden for utilsigtet tab af data. Hvis der ikke er taget backup af dataene, kan det være umuligt at gendanne tabte oplysninger. Derfor er det vigtigt at have en klar strategi for dataopbevaring og -sikkerhed, før man anvender truncation i praksis.
Best Practices for Brug af ‘Truncate’
Forberedelse Før Truncation
Før man anvender truncation, er det vigtigt at forberede sig ordentligt. Dette inkluderer at tage backup af relevante data og sikre sig, at alle nødvendige brugere er informerede om ændringen. At have en klar forståelse af konsekvenserne ved truncation kan forhindre unødvendige fejl og datatab.
Efter Truncation: Hvad Skal Man Være Opmærksom På?
Efter anvendelse af truncation skal man være opmærksom på, hvordan systemet reagerer. Det er vigtigt at kontrollere, at alle systemfunktioner fortsætter med at fungere som forventet, og at ingen uventede problemer opstår. Evaluering af systemets ydeevne efter truncation kan give værdifuld indsigt i effektiviteten af denne metode.
Truncate i Andre Kontekster
Brug af Truncate i Filhåndtering
I filhåndtering er truncation nyttigt til at ændre størrelsen på filer. Programudviklere kan anvende metoder til at forkorte eller fjerne uønskede data fra filer, hvilket kan være særlig vigtigt i ressourcetunge applikationer. Det sikrer, at kun de mest relevante oplysninger opbevares.
Truncate i Dataanalyse
Dataanalytikere bruger også truncation til at forenkle datasæt, når de arbejder med store mængder af information. Ved at fjerne overflødige data kan de fokusere på de mest relevante oplysninger, hvilket kan føre til mere præcise analyser og resultater. Truncation kan derfor være et kraftfuldt værktøj i dataanalyse.
Fremtidige Trends for ‘Truncate’
Udviklingen af Truncate i Cloud Computing
Med den stigende udbredelse af cloud computing bliver truncation stadig mere relevant. Cloud-baserede systemer kræver effektive metoder til datastyring, og truncation kan spille en vigtig rolle i at optimere ydeevnen. Fremtidige udviklinger kan føre til endnu mere avancerede former for truncation, der bedre understøtter skalerbarhed i cloud-miljøer.
Truncate og Big Data: Hvad Kan Vi Forvente?
I takt med at big data fortsat vokser, vil behovet for effektive datahåndteringsmetoder som truncation også stige. Det er sandsynligt, at vi vil se udviklingen af nye værktøjer og teknologier, der gør det muligt for virksomheder at håndtere store datamængder mere effektivt. Truncation kan blive en integreret del af den fremtidige datahåndtering i store datamiljøer.
Konklusion
Opsummering af Vigtigheden af ‘Truncate’
Generelt set er truncation en vigtig metode i både IT og datahåndtering. Dens evne til effektivt at fjerne store mængder data gør den til en uundgåelig del af mange systemer. At forstå, hvordan og hvornår man anvender truncation, kan have en betydelig indflydelse på et systems ydeevne og på kvaliteten af de resultater, man opnår.
Afsluttende Tanker om Truncate i IT
Som vi bevæger os ind i fremtiden, vil truncation fortsat spille en central rolle i dataverse. Det vil være vigtigt for både udviklere og databaseringsadministratorer at forstå de bedste metoder til at implementere denne teknik og være opmærksom på de potentielle risici der følger med. Med korrekt anvendelse kan truncation være et uvurderligt værktøj i enhver databehandlingsstrategi.